    What to Expect During the Procedure

    Neck liposuction is typically performed under local anesthesia with sedation or general anesthesia, depending on the patient's preference and the surgeon's recommendation. The procedure involves making small incisions in the neck area to insert a cannula, which is used to suction out the excess fat. Post-operative care includes wearing a compression garment to help reduce swelling and support the healing process. Patients can expect some downtime, with most returning to normal activities within a week to ten days.

    What Does the Cost Include?

    When considering the cost of neck liposuction, it's essential to understand what the quoted price includes. Typically, the cost covers the surgeon's fee, anesthesia fees, facility fees, and any post-operative garments or medications. Some clinics may also include follow-up consultations in the initial cost, while others may charge separately for these services. It's always advisable to clarify these details with your surgeon before proceeding with the procedure.
